PROCEDURE TO ADDRESS CITY COUNCIL: If you wish to address the City Council,
please complete a Speaker Request Form, indicating the agenda item number and submit it
to the City Clerk. There will be a maximum 30-minute period for comments on any
subject with a 3-minute time limit on each speaker, unless waived by Council. You have
the opportunity to address the City Council at the following times:
• AGEND A ITEM: at the time the Council considers the agenda item;
• NON-AGENDA ITEM: at the time for PUBLIC COMMENTS. Please note that while
the City Council values your comments, pursuant to the Brown Act, the Council cannot
take action on any item not listed on the agenda; and
• PUBLIC HEARING: at the time for public hearings under PUBLIC HEARING.
The listing of any item on the agenda includes the authority of the Council to
take action on such item and to approve, disapprove, or give direction on any item.

D. APPROVAL OF A VENDOR AGREEMENT FOR SERVICE WITH GOLDEN
EAGLE AVIATION SERVICE INC. FOR A FLYOVER DURING THE
VETERAN’S DAY CELEBRATION
Approval of the Vendor’s Agreement for Service with Golden Eagle Aviation will
allow for a flyover during the City’s Veteran’s Day Celebration on November 11,
2017.
Recommendation:
1. Approve the City to purchase Aircraft Liability Insurance in the amount of
$10,000,000 to cover City’s aircraft exposure;
2. Approve a Vendor Agreement For Service with Golden Eagle Aviation
Service Inc. for a flyover during the City’s Veteran’s Day Celebration; and
3. Authorize the City Manager to sign the Agreement.
